Jackie Dana

Jackie Dana built her first website from scratch in 1995. She now considers herself to be a WordPress evangelist, believing that WordPress allows people to have a beautiful website or blog regardless of their technical background or financial situation. She values the principles of universal design and usability, and encourages all web sites to support good design practices and thoughtful organization. She also follows the latest trends in social media marketing and strongly advocates the use of technologies such as Facebook and Twitter, in tandem with traditional marketing, to promote both online and brick and mortar businesses.

She is a leader of WordPress Austin, and serves on UT Austin’s Refresh Project, a campus-wide committee that redesigned the University’s homepage. As a supporter of web accessibility, she volunteers for the local organization Knowbility and participates in AIR Austin competitions to build accessible websites for artists and nonprofit organizations.

Jackie owns Getting Dirty Designs, providing WordPress training, consulting and web design. She also blogs about technical topics at Bending the Web to my Will.

Nicholas R. Batik

Nicholas R. Batik

My passion is Information design — the art and science of preparing information so that it can be used efficiently and effectively. As lead designer with Pleiades Publishing Services, I focus on the development of information graphics – the diagramming and display of quantitative information to communicate ideas and information. My underlying philosophy of graphic design, ideography, graphic symbolology, photography, and digital art is to display information so it is both useful, and attractive.

Since founding Pleiades Publishing Services in 1992, I have been involved with both print, and electronic media design. As a web developer I have content, design and the technology experience in major web site design and implementation, including Project Manager/ Senior Designer and programmer of a 2,400 page, 2,500+ image, 18,000+ link database-driven web site created back in 1994. My work with Pleiades Publishing Services reflects my passion for elegant and effective information design and is dedicated to using design technology to communicate, and manage Information in a way that is beneficial to our clients and our clients’ customers. As principle information architect I focus on the science of information acquisition, interpretation and processing. I am responsible for publication design – assuring the message content and language are clear, unambiguous and understandable. As lead designer for Pleiades Publishing services I have focused on our clients; need for multimedia information design in the form of, electronic publishing projects, as well as scriptwriting and audio/ video production.

Over my 30-years as an information designer I have researched and used a number of publishing platforms. Since 2006, I have used WordPress exclusively as my website development tool. It’s functionality, confirmation to web standards and ease of use for both the designer and the end user, facilitate and support elegant information design. I act as trainer and support for all of my clients. WordPress is the first tool that truly allows the web owner to control the content as well as the look and feel of the site.

I have written numerous training courses, articles and seminars on design, and publishing. I conduct one-on-one training, and have lectured at publishing conferences and in-house seminars in over 100 cities across the US, England, and Scandinavia.

I write extensively and have both management and technical articles published, and have authored white papers on technical project management.

H. Sandra Chevalier-Batik

H. Sandra Chevalier-Batik’s insights and expertise with all levels of business start-up and development, as well as her experience in the public, corporate and small business environments, uniquely qualify her as an internet marketing and on-line business consultant.  She has conducted over 300 seminars and workshops and has been a featured speaker at numerous national and international publishing conferences. Sandra has earned a reputation for taking highly complex subjects and presenting them in easily understood modules.  Her informal approach helps put attendees at ease and ready to tackle unfamiliar material.

Sandra is a research analyst and web content developer as well as a partner in Pleiades Publishing Services.  As a professional researcher and information technologist, she studies technical data, conducts client-sponsored research, develops feasibility studies, competition and market analyses; and provides reports, white papers, articles, press releases, training materials as well as Search Engine Optimized web content, including, newsletters, blogs, and e-books.

Tracking through statistical data, and oblique cross-references to find the relevant connections that help  clients solve a problem, or take action on a business venture is her passion.  As a web content developer, Sandra’s reward is when a client reports that their site is bringing in customers and making them money.

Lindsey Allen

Lindsey Allen  teaches or has taught HTML, XHTML, CSS, Javascript, Java, Photoshop, Paint Shop Pro, Beginning Programming, PHP, MySQL, ASP, at the academic level (University of Texas, Austin Community College), governmental (Texas State Government), and corporate level (Cadence Systems). Many of his classes were taught online.

Lindsey  is the Chief Exploring Officer (CEO) of Exploring New Media.  He learns most of what he knows by continually examining new topics, discarding what doesn’t work or no longer interests him, hones and fine tunes those that do.  He is a retired Air Force officer, a college level instructor, founder and leader of multiple meetups, web developer, and game player. He currently leads the Austin Podcast meetup group and co-leads the Austin WordPress meetup group.

Pat Ramsey

Pat is the Design Chief & Accessibility Guru Extraordinaire for slash25 code. Specializing in standards-based design, Pat believes in making code that works… beautifully. He leads the Austin WordPress meetup group and is active in Refresh Austin, a group of Web professionals “refreshing” the creative, technical, and professional aspects of their trade. Pat serves as both an adviser and trainer for Knowbility’s Accessible Internet Rallies. He’s been a speaker on the topics of accessibility and web standards at events around the country.
